What affects the price

Roof repair costs depend on several specific factors. The size of the damaged area is the biggest variable, along with the accessibility of your roof and the pitch or steepness involved. We also look at the underlying materials—like whether you have standard asphalt shingles, metal, or tile—and the complexity of the flashing around chimneys or vents. About this service

Roof cleaning removes moss, algae, and dark stains that can trap moisture and slowly deteriorate your shingles. Routine cleaning helps extend the life of your roof by preventing organic growth from lifting materials or causing rot. You should look into this if your roof looks discolored or if you notice moss patches forming in shaded areas. Pricing typically fluctuates based on the roof’s pitch and total surface area. What are the common issues with red roofs in Miami?

Red roofs in Miami, often constructed from clay or concrete tiles, can experience issues like cracking, chipping, or dislodgement due to intense sunlight, heavy rainfall, and strong winds. Moss or algae growth can also occur in humid conditions. The specialized nature of tile roofing requires careful inspection and repair by professionals experienced with these materials to maintain their integrity and appearance.

Are polycarbonate roof panels suitable for Miami's climate?

Polycarbonate roof panels can be a suitable option in Miami, offering good impact resistance against hail and debris. Their UV-protective coatings help mitigate damage from intense sunlight. However, their thermal expansion and contraction rates need careful consideration during installation to prevent warping or stress on fasteners. They offer a lightweight, durable alternative for certain applications.

What types of roof tiles are common in Miami?

Clay roof tiles are a classic and prevalent choice in Miami, offering excellent durability and a distinctive aesthetic that complements the region's architecture. Concrete roof tiles are also widely used, providing a more budget-friendly option with similar benefits in terms of longevity and weather resistance. Both types are well-suited to withstand the subtropical climate, offering reliable protection.

What should I look for during a roof inspection in Miami?

During a roof inspection in Miami, professionals will check for signs of damage from intense sun exposure, such as curling or brittle shingles. They'll examine flashing around vents and chimneys for corrosion or displacement, and assess tile roofs for cracks or missing pieces. The inspection also includes checking for signs of water intrusion in the attic and ensuring proper drainage. Attention to coastal wind resistance is key.

What is involved in roof installation in Miami?

Roof installation in Miami involves preparing the roof deck, installing protective underlayment resistant to moisture, and then applying the chosen roofing material, such as impact-resistant shingles or metal panels. Proper sealing and fastening are critical to withstand high winds and heavy rain. Specialists ensure all flashing and ventilation systems are correctly installed to maximize performance and longevity in the subtropical climate.

What is roof sealant and how is it used?

Roof sealant is a flexible, adhesive material used to fill gaps, cracks, and seams, preventing water intrusion. In Miami, it's crucial for sealing around vents, skylights, flashing, and joints in various roofing materials. Proper application ensures a watertight bond, extending the life of the roof and preventing leaks caused by heat, humidity, and storms. Selecting the right sealant for the material is key.

What are the benefits of steel roofs?

Steel roofs offer exceptional durability and longevity, capable of withstanding Miami's harsh weather conditions, including high winds and heavy rain. They are fire-resistant and can be coated to reflect solar heat, contributing to energy efficiency. Steel roofs are also resistant to rot, insects, and most forms of decay. Their robust construction provides reliable, long-term protection for your home.
